Trevor Hopkins and Chelsey Farley injured in crash by Lake Springfield

The content of this page is covered by and subject to our legal disclaimer

Thursday's accident was on East Lake Shore Drive near Laconwood Drive, authorities say

September 05, 2024 | Springfield, IL

A motorcycle ridden by two Springfield residents was involved in a crash with a retired police sergeant near Lake Springfield Thursday night, police said. According to the Illinois State Police, a Toyota Tundra was traveling north on East Lake Shore Drive near Laconwood Drive around 9:20 p.m. when the driver turned left in front of a southbound Kawasaki motorcycle, resulting in a crash. Two people on the bike—Trevor Hopkins and Chelsey Farley—were ejected and transported to the hospital.

motorcycle accidentA Springfield police officer was ticketed for a crash near Lake Springfield Thursday night that left two Springfield residents with serious injuries, according to police.

The Toyota driver, who authorities say failed to yield the right-of-way to the motorcycle, was ticketed for the crash.

Authorities identified the Toyota driver as a 50-year-old former Springfield Police officer.

Police are investigating.
